Output 7a1129682fe75353fd9b00f583133895fac1c23db7d96c0b043fa519fd9ad51a:63

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 cc4aeee8180330e7c7c8e556ac3292c4eb43232e
address
bc1qe39wa6qcqvcw037gu4t2cv5jcn45xgewp8lzly
transaction
7a1129682fe75353fd9b00f583133895fac1c23db7d96c0b043fa519fd9ad51a
spent
true